Russians shelled a railway in the Sumy region: an employee was injured.


In the Sumy region, as a result of Russian shelling, a railway worker was injured. The woman was hospitalized with injuries. This was reported by the joint-stock company "Ukrzaliznytsia" on Telegram.
The company stated that on October 6, a railway crossing was affected due to the shelling.
"The railway worker with a shoulder injury was taken to the hospital, where she received all the necessary assistance," said "UZ".
The company also reported that the Russian strikes damaged the railway infrastructure in the Sumy region, including power supply elements and the track.
It is worth noting that railway infrastructure objects often become targets for enemy shelling. "UZ" employees also become victims of Russian attacks.
